About D9972 — External Bleaching — Per Arch

External Bleaching, coded as D9972, refers to the process of whitening teeth using bleaching agents applied to the entire arch. This procedure is indicated for patients seeking to improve the color of their teeth due to intrinsic or extrinsic stains. Documentation should include the patient's dental history, the shade of teeth before treatment, and the materials used. This procedure is often covered by dental insurance, but reimbursement can vary widely depending on the payor and state regulations. Average reimbursement for D9972 is approximately $542, but some plans may classify it as cosmetic and deny coverage. Always confirm coverage details with the patient's insurance provider before proceeding.
